Output ac60d21817b8e504c6b402a3a89a18b865e955d2bfa96217e8134132bef29e6e:367

value
3042668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38c1af910841f9f29f4ac3008f2eae5a2bf1f50c OP_EQUAL
address
36s7np3wxoCQdoiEfAqMTMTb5W6kptKJoP
transaction
ac60d21817b8e504c6b402a3a89a18b865e955d2bfa96217e8134132bef29e6e
confirmations
328960
spent
true